HEALTH, HIV/AIDS AND TB PROJECT

REQUEST FOR CURRICULUM VITAE FOR A CONSULTANT TO CONDUCT CAPACITY BUILDING ON MEDICAL EQUIPMENT MAINTENANCE SERVICES FOR THE BIOMEDICAL ENGINEERING DEPARTMENT.

Background Information

The Government of Swaziland has received financing from the International Bank for Reconstruction and Development (IBRD) towards the cost of a five-year Health HIV/AIDS and TB Project in the amount of US$20 Million equivalent. This project is jointly financed by the European Union in the amount of Euro 14.5 million.

The project has three components: thefirst two, (i) strengthening the capacity of the health sector and (ii) facility-level support to improve access, quality and efficiency ofservices will be implemented by the Ministry of Health (MOH) and the third, (iii) strengthening of the orphans and vulnerable children safety net will be implemented by the DPM's Office.

The Health, HIV/AIDS and TB Project, has made provision for a consultancy to strengthen and build capacity on Medical Equipment Maintenance Services for the Ministry of Health, Swaziland.

The main purpose of the consultancy is to provide knowledge and skills to the MOH Central Biomedical Engineering Unit and Regional Medical Equipment Technicians in order to establish sustainable maintenance and management procedures for medical equipment. Further, the capacity building will ensure that diagnostic capacity is increased and the down time of medical equipment is limited.

The MOH now invites interested, qualified candidates to indicate their interest in providing technical support and services under this consultancy. The duration of this Consultancy is Thirty (30) days. Selection shall be on the basis of examination and comparison of the qualifications of the individual candidates as evidenced by their CVs. The selected individual shall be requested to submit a costed offer to undertake the work.

Description of Services

The consultant will deliver an induction course on management, maintenance and repair of medical equipment to Bio-Medical Engineering Unit Technicians (and selected regional level technicians).

This training course will build capacity in the following areas:

  • Principles of design and operation of medical devices.
  • Trouble-shooting capacity for fault finding on broken down or inoperative equipment
  • Repair procedures including electronic circuits of medical devices.
  • Management and maintenance process of a wide range of medical equipment, including:

§ Life Support Equipment

ü Defibrillators, anaesthesia machines, critical care ventilators, infusion and syringe pumps etc.

§ Operating Room

ü Endoscopy, electro-surgical equipment, sterilizers, warmers etc.

§ Monitoring Systems

ü Electrocardiogram & ECG machines, blood pressure monitor, pulse oximeter, foetal monitor etc.

§ Therapeutic Equipment

ü Infant warmers, incubators, ultrasound

§ Test Equipment.

ü Oscilloscopes, meters, simulators

  • Electrical safety of medical equipment.
  • Basic principles and implementation procedures of Medical equipmentaudit and assets management.
  • Consultant will also provide:

ü A detailed work plan for the development of the induction course including the technical contents and training methodology (oriented mainly to a Hands-On Training).

ü The necessary training materials (other than the equipment which will be provided by MOH Biomed Unit).

ü Documentation confirming all instances of the training course, including attendance lists, photographs, practical exercises, evaluation results and certifications.

ü Evaluations and Certifications to the trainees

ü An implementation plan for the BiomedicalMaintenance Units at national and regional levels And a Management Plan for the national level Biomedical Engineering Unit as well as the implementation of regional Biomedical Engineering Units ( including thelogic Framework, indicators as well as critical and support activities).

Required Qualifications

  • A bachelor's degree/ Bachelor of Technology (B-tech) in Biomedical Engineer, Clinical Engineer or equivalent. A Master's degree on Health Facilities planning, health technology assessment or equivalent will be an added advantage.
  • Have at least five (5) years of hands-on experience at health facility level in Biomedical engineering, specifically in the area Medical Equipment Maintenance and Repair Capacity Building in developing countries (Not less than three experiences in the last seven years in developing countries). Sub-Saharan Africa experience will be an added advantage.
  • Have seven (7) years proven experience in the development of Management Plans for Biomedical Engineering Units or Electro-Medical departments in developing countries (at least three experiences in the last seven years).
